I started to stitch when my children (now adults) started school, studying Contemporary Applied Arts at University of Cumbria. I spent several years teaching in secondary education alongside developing my own business.
My work is a quirky interpretation of our surroundings, with a bit of a bird theme running through it. I use the sewing machine as my drawing tool to create applique and free-machine embroidered images which I develop into ranges of homeware, accessories and unique 3d pieces, exhibited across the UK. I’m a hoarder of buttons and fabrics and can spend hours hunting out just the right tiny piece for a particular detail . I like to have fun with my work and I hope it shows through.
